Treatment of Diabetic Foot Ulcers With AUP1602-C
Phase 1, PHASE2 trial testing AUP1602-C in Diabetic Foot Ulcer in 26 participants. Completed in 20 March 2023.

Who can join
Adults 18 to 80, any sex, with Diabetic Foot Ulcer. Patients with the condition only — healthy volunteers not accepted.
Sponsor's own description
This is a two-part phase 1/2A study performed in diabetic foot ulcer (DFU) patients with chronic non-healing wounds to investigate the safety and efficacy of AUP1602-C.
